Hugh Muntz Park in Beenleigh offers free camping with basic facilities like toilets, a dump point, and picnic tables, making it handy for travellers and locals alike. It's close to shops, a train station, and major roads, which adds to its convenience. However, multiple reviews highlight that the park has become a temporary home for many homeless people, leading to safety concerns, noise at night, and litter issues. Families and tourists should be cautious, especially after dark. The parkβs natural greenery and picnic spots show potential but are overshadowed by ongoing social challenges.

β What Makes This Park Special
Easy Access & Handy Facilities π
Hugh Muntz Park scores well for convenience, being right next to Beenleigh Marketplace and the train station. Travellers appreciate the free dump point and public toilets on site, though some mention the toilets aren't always spotless. The park has bitumen parking spaces for about 30 vehicles, but arriving early is key as spots fill up quickly, especially for larger vehicles. With shops, a pub, and supermarkets just a short walk away, you can grab supplies or a quick feed without fuss. Itβs a practical spot for a short stay or a quick pit stop on your travels.
Things to Keep in Mind When Visiting β οΈ
While the park offers useful facilities, many reviews warn about safety concerns due to a large number of homeless people living in tents throughout the park. Noise from late-night gatherings, occasional fights, and drug use have been reported, making it less ideal for families or solo travellers. The park is also noisy from nearby highway traffic. Arriving before late afternoon is advised to secure parking. If youβre after a peaceful arvo or a safe overnight stay, consider alternative spots or visit during daylight hours only.
Green Spaces & Picnic Spots π³
Despite the challenges, Hugh Muntz Park features grassy areas with picnic tables and some shady spots, offering a chance to sit down and enjoy a brekkie or arvo snack. Some reviewers noted the park is neat and tidy in parts, with potential for a nice outdoor hangout. The natural greenery and open space could be a ripper place for families to relax if the social issues were addressed. For now, itβs best to keep an eye on surroundings and stick to daylight hours for a quieter experience.
